Well look at it this yay:

2004: Orlando but why? It was done on the grounds of disneyworld plus it was so dang close to the other parks in the area it was a waste of time to argue that it shouldent.

2005: San Diego and why? It was done because most of wizards BIG events ended in san diego and they wanted this event to be back home for a year to give some memories.

2006: Anaheim and why again? Well its really defined in one woird: DISNEYLAND!
The POP crew wanted it there so they can have a place for kids to go a day or 2 before and for people to enjoy something

Next year expect it to be somewhere where its close to great amusemnet parks and family fun. I cant see if its gonna be in the USA or the world.
